Karthick Naren’s Naragasooran to release on OTT platforms first

Due to the COVID-19 outbreak and other reasons, the film is likely to be released on digital platforms Karthick Naren’s Naragasooran is all set to release on OTT platforms before hitting theatres, sources closely associated to the film said.

Earlier, the movie had faced financial issues forcing postponement of release. As a result, Karthick Naren and Gautham Vasudev Menon who produced the film under his banner, Ondraga

Entertainment, had a row.

The duo took to Twitter to voice their differences. It started when Gautham Menon, announced that his much-delayed film Dhruva Natchathiram, starring Vikram,was in its post-production stages.Gautham

added, “The film is close to my heart”. Karthick immediately responded to the tweet and said, “Some clarity on when this is gonna see the light of the day will be really helpful sir. And yes, this film (Naragasooran) is very very close to my heart.” 

After months of delay, Naragasooran was scheduled to release on March 27. However, due to the coronavirus pandemic, the release was yet again postponed by the makers. Karthick recently conducted a poll on Instagram and asked fans if he should release Naragasooran directly on OTT platforms which saw many voting ‘Yes’.

Naragasooran features an ensemble cast including Aravind Swamy, Shriya Saran, Sundeep Kishan, Aathmika and Indrajith Sukumaran. Karthick Naren made his directorial debut with the 2016 film Dhuruvangal Pathinaaru which received critical acclaim.
